None of the Manitobans fit but this does, just over in Ontario, and the only FF 93.5 in Ont. per WTFDA Database: ``CKSB-7-FM relays CKSB-1050 93.5 KENORA ON French NEWS/TALK ICI RADIO-CANADA PREMIERE 20.0 kW H&V 100.0m HAAT 49-46-06 94-30-17`` CBC acquired the private CKSB 1050 St-Boniface long ago and added it to its French network, kept the callsign, not CBWF. I guess it had been a private affiliate of CBC/SRC. 1542 km = 958 stmi from Kenora to Enid, ideal Es distance. 93.1, May 31 at 2227 UT, telco-quality talk in English by a native person about ceremonies, residential schools, the scandal in BC. ``First Nations`` terminology which is typically Canadian but may be spreading south of the border, where it should be banned for the sake of DX identification. On 5/31/21 10:26 PM, Glenn Hauser wrote: ``95.3, May 31 at 2225 UT and continually, KOKC OKC talk is solid; hard to believe it`s just a 250-watt translator K237GE of 10 kW 1520; but it does have high-tower advantage, I think, tho WTFDA has default 0.0 entries for HAAT!`` --- Doug Smith replies on the WTFDA gg: An FM translator can (often does) have *twelve* HAATs and for that reason, most don't have a HAAT entry in the FCC database. (For full-power stations, "average terrain" is calculated along eight radials, every 45 degrees, around the tower; then, all eight radials are averaged. For translators, twelve radials are used -- and the highest radial determines the maximum permissible power.) You can calculate the HAAT of a translator (or any other station) on this page: https://www.fcc.gov/media/radio/haat-calculator It has no legal standing but allows you to compare a translator's coverage to a full-power station's on an equal basis`` (Glenn Hauser, OK, WOR) ** OKLAHOMA.
